.fs-c-button--subscribeToArrivalNotice--list{
	display:none !importa;
}

.fs-c-productName__copy{
	display:none !important;
}

/*
.fs-c-productName__name{
	overflow: hidden;
	text-overflow: ellipsis;
	white-space: nowrap;
}
*/

.fs-c-productPrice--listed{display:none;}

.fs-c-productPrice--listed + .fs-c-productPrice--selling span.fs-c-productPrice__main .fs-c-price__currencyMark, .fs-c-productPrice--listed + .fs-c-productPrice--selling span.fs-c-productPrice__main .fs-c-price__value{
	color:#cc0000;
	font-weight:bold;
}

.fs-c-productPrice__addon{display:none!important;}

.fs-c-productList h2{
	font-size: 14px;
	padding-bottom:0;
	margin-bottom: 8px;
	border:none !important;
}

.fs-l-pageMain h2 span::before, .fs-l-pageMain h2 span::after{
	content:"";
}

.fs-c-button--plain.fs-c-button--viewMoreImage::before{
	font-size:2.0rem;
}

.fs-c-productMark__item .noreview, .fs-c-productMark__item .noreturn{
	display:none;
}

button.fs-c-button--subscribeToArrivalNotice--list.fs-c-button--plain{
	display:none;
}

div.fs-c-productListItem__control.fs-c-buttonContainer > a{display:none;}

.fs-c-productListItem__outOfStock + .fs-c-productListItem__control{display:none;}

/*お気に入りボタン位置固定*/
.fs-c-productList__list__item{
	position:relative;
}

.fs-c-productListItem__control{
	position: absolute;
	right: 15px;
	bottom: 8px;
}


/*サムネ内商品マークと虫眼鏡ボタン位置固定*/
div.image_container{position:relative;}
.fs-c-productListItem__viewMoreImageButton{position:absolute;bottom:5px;right:5px;}
.fs-c-productMark{display:block;}
.fs-c-productMark > li{display:table;margin-top:2px;}
.fs-c-productMark__mark{font-size:10px;padding:4px;}
div.image_container .fs-c-productMarks{position:absolute;bottom:5px;left:5px;}